What volume to choose for a dumpster?

Once the type of dumpster has been selected (covered or not, standard or reinforced, with or without a walkway, etc.), it is time to consider the capacity of garbage it can contain . There are 3 main size categories:
  • 7 or 8 m³ waste skip  ;
  • skip with a volume of 15 to 25 m³  ;
  • dumpster with a capacity of 30 m³ or more;

In order to select the appropriate waste container, it is necessary to first conduct an upstream analysis of the total amount of waste that has accumulated between two readings. In other words, the time frame during which there will be no emptying of the waste container. However, this alone is not sufficient to find the dumpster that will work best for your needs; you must also pay attention to the tonnage it can support. For instance, cardboard and scrap metal have very different weights despite having the same volume, so this factor is very important to consider. It is imperative that the height of the dumpster be taken into consideration at all times in order to ensure that those who will be utilizing it will have an easy time depositing their trash inside of it.

The back room of a store is not the appropriate location for a box that is two meters high because it is not easy to access. However, a box of this height may be useful in an industrial area for businesses that do not want their dumpsters to become contaminated by waste brought in from the outside.

The selection of volume is also dependent on the amount of free space that is available in order for the waste collection equipment to be installed.

Not only is it necessary that the tipper be able to be positioned in such a way that it is practical for its users and does not obstruct the passage, but it is also necessary that it be able to be positioned in such a way that the vehicles that come to collect them are able to correctly carry out their maneuver.

Because of this, when working with limited space, it is necessary to make trade-offs between the amount of height, length, and width that can be accommodated in order to find the optimal solution.

What size dumpster should you get?

The design of the dumpster is an additional essential aspect to take into account. This pertains to its shape in addition to the opening and spillage systems that it possesses.

Dumpsters that are standard in size and are rectangular are often an excellent choice for companies that outsource the management of their garbage collection and disposal. Due to the fact that these containers can be detached from suitable vehicles and relocated to suitable platforms, they are also known as removable dumpsters.

Self-tipping skips are often the best option when choosing a waste skip for installation on a production site or in a warehouse, for example. A straightforward forklift is all that is required to manage them before moving them to a more capacious dumpster. Dumpsters on wheels are even easier to use, but their capacity is significantly lower than that of other types.

Because the service provider or community that manages skip emptying and repatriation can impose the use of a particular type of skip in order to standardize collections, businesses may find that they have few options to choose from in certain circumstances. You should, whenever it is possible to do so, look for a service provider who will be able to meet your specific needs, both in terms of the frequency of collection and the equipment and skips that are compatible with the services that it provides.

Should multiple bins be used to sort waste?

When placing an order for a dumpster, it is essential to take into consideration the various kinds of waste that will be placed inside of it. To begin, it is required of businesses to sort their waste, specifically into categories such as paper, plastic, wood, and glass. As a consequence of this, in order to fulfill the requirements of the regulations, it is often necessary to make use of more than one skip. A compartmentalized skip with several sealed bins is an alternative option. This type of skip is used to collect waste that will not be treated in the same manner as the other waste.

In addition to this, you need to be aware that the skips are categorized and colored according to the different kinds of waste and scrap they are able to hold. Because each skip serves a different function, having a number of them available is beneficial, especially for businesses that are involved in the construction industry, road maintenance, or even manufacturing plants. It is against the law, for instance, to throw away yard waste in a dumpster intended for wood or to throw away electronic waste in a dumpster intended for metal.
